Okopy
Okopy is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Dorohusk, within Chełm County, Lublin Voivodeship, in eastern Poland, close to the border with Ukraine.- Type: Village with 422 residents

Dorohusk
Village
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
Dorohusk is a village in Chełm County, Lublin Voivodeship, in southeastern Poland, at the border with Ukraine. It is the seat of Gmina Dorohusk. The landmark of Dorohusk is the Suchodolski Palace, a Baroque palace built by the Suchodolski family in the 18th century. Dorohusk is situated 3 km southeast of Okopy.
